Daily weather update for West Bengal on Thursday (17 September)

Risk level: Low Country: India

The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ued the following Forecast and Nowcast warnings for West Bengal on Thursday (17 September), as per the District-wise forecast PDF documents issued on Wednesday (16 September).

• Forecast: An orange alert for thunderstorms accompanied by lightning and gusty winds reaching 30 to 40 kilometres per hour at one or two places has been issued for Howrah, Hooghly, Purba Medinipur, Paschim Medinipur, Jhargram, Purulia and Bankura.
• Forecast: A yellow alert for thunderstorms accompanied by lightning, gusty winds reaching 30 to 40 kilometres per hour and heavy rainfall measuring seven to 11 centimetres at one or two places has been issued for Jalpaiguri and Alipurduar, while a yellow alert for thunderstorms accompanied by lightning and gusty winds reaching 30 to 40 kilometres per hour at one or two places has been issued for Kolkata, North 24 Parganas, South 24 Parganas, Purba Bardhaman, Paschim Bardhaman, Birbhum, Murshidabad, Nadia, Darjeeling, Kalimpong, Cooch Behar, Uttar Dinajpur, Dakshin Dinajpur and Malda.
• Nowcast: A yellow alert for light rainfall measuring less than five millimetres per hour and light thunderstorms with maximum surface wind speeds below 40 kilometres per hour has been issued across all districts of West Bengal. The alert is valid until 0300 hours (local time) on Thursday (17 September).
